Iran launched a new wave of attacks against Israel today (June 17, 2025), shortly after 6:45 PM Greek time, as reported by the country’s state television network. These new strikes appear to be retaliation for earlier Israeli airstrikes that destroyed dozens of missile systems and military installations in western Iran. Specifically, ‘the Israeli air force carried out a series of strikes in western Iran,’ according to a military statement, which noted that installations and dozens of ground-to-ground missile launchers were targeted. Explosions were also reported in Isfahan, as relayed by the Mehr News Agency, amid escalating tensions between Iran and Israel. The situation in the Middle East is described as ‘explosive’ as tensions continue to rise, with Israel vowing to strike strategic infrastructure and nuclear facilities in Tehran. Earlier, Israel’s Defense Minister, Israel Katz, stated, ‘Today we will hit very significant targets in Iran, strategic and governmental infrastructures within Tehran.’ The escalation follows an announcement by the Israeli Defense Forces that during the night of June 16, Israeli air forces destroyed the secret headquarters of Iran’s Central Command (Khatam-al Anbiya). More than 450 people have been killed in Iran since the start of the latest round of conflicts with Israel on Friday, according to a human rights organization. Air raid sirens sounded tonight in the Dimona region following missile launches from Iran toward southern Israel, known for its nuclear facility.
